John C. McGinley has played countless roles over the course of his 40-year career — but to many fans, he’ll always be Dr. Perry Cox, the hard-charging mentor of J.D. (Zach Braff) on beloved medical comedy Scrubs. The series, which ran from 2001 to 2010, airing for seven season on ABC before jumping to NBC for its final two, is in the process of being revived, with Braff the first cast member to officially sign on. But, as McGinley told Channel Guide, he is also planning to participate in the revival.

McGinley, whose 2024 Hallmark+ holiday series Holidazed will air on the Hallmark Channel this summer as part of their “Christmas in July” programming, told Channel Guide that he’s staying very busy with work, and anticipates being involved in the Scrubs revival soon.
